Transaction 89526e90a90e8e42de403dce20b78f6656a194f5dc482c804507f010e44cde9f
1 Input
1 Output
-
89526e90a90e8e42de403dce20b78f6656a194f5dc482c804507f010e44cde9f:0
- value
- 1525634
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1688a4e1ccb3b4c1c3b1241eb59d5f3154cb6f03 OP_EQUAL
- address
- 33kAUxfK14aZfQcjQ5tLufU4QqFgMJytKG